What Is Acemcp?

Acemcp is a software tool in the infrastructure category: Indexes codebases with automatic incremental updates and provides semantic search to find relevant code snippets with file paths and line numbers.. It has 799 GitHub stars. Nerq Trust Score: 50/100 (D).

How to Verify Acemcp's Safety Yourself

While Nerq provides automated trust analysis, we recommend these additional steps before adopting any software tool:

  1. Check the source code — Review the repository security policy, open issues, and recent commits for signs of active maintenance.
  2. Scan dependencies — Use tools like npm audit, pip-audit, or snyk to check for known vulnerabilities in Acemcp's dependency tree.
  3. Review permissions — Understand what access Acemcp requires. Software tools should follow the principle of least privilege.
  4. Test in isolation — Run Acemcp in a sandboxed environment before granting access to production data or systems.
  5. Monitor continuously — Use Nerq's API to set up automated trust checks: GET nerq.ai/v1/preflight?target=Acemcp
  6. Review the license — Confirm that Acemcp's license is compatible with your intended use case. Pay attention to restrictions on commercial use, redistribution, and derivative works. Some AI tools use dual licensing or have separate terms for enterprise customers that differ from the open-source license.
  7. Check community signals — Look at the project's issue tracker, discussion forums, and social media presence. A healthy community actively reports bugs, contributes fixes, and discusses security concerns openly. Low community engagement may indicate limited peer review of the codebase.

Common Safety Concerns with Acemcp

When evaluating whether Acemcp is safe, consider these category-specific risks:

Data handling

Understand how Acemcp processes, stores, and transmits your data. Review the tool's privacy policy and data retention practices, especially for sensitive or proprietary information.

Dependency security

Check Acemcp's dependency tree for known vulnerabilities. Tools with outdated or unmaintained dependencies pose a higher security risk.

Update frequency

Regularly check for updates to Acemcp. Security patches and bug fixes are only effective if you're running the latest version.

Third-party integrations

If Acemcp connects to external APIs or services, each integration point is a potential attack surface. Audit all third-party connections, verify that data shared with external services is minimized, and ensure that integration credentials are rotated regularly.

License and IP compliance

Verify that Acemcp's license is compatible with your intended use case. Some AI tools have restrictive licenses that limit commercial use, redistribution, or derivative works. Using Acemcp in violation of its license can expose your organization to legal liability.
